- Fishing Techniques.
The Large Light Heavy Stonefly Nymph is best used in fast-flowing rivers where stoneflies are prevalent. To maximise effectiveness, employ a dead-drift presentation by casting upstream and allowing the fly to drift naturally with the current. Use a strike indicator to detect subtle takes. For added realism, incorporate a slight twitch or lift at the end of the drift to mimic a nymph's natural movement.
When retrieving, use a slow, steady hand-twist retrieve to imitate the nymph's crawling action along the riverbed. Target areas behind rocks, in riffles, and near submerged structures where trout are likely to be feeding.

How does the Turrall Large Light Heavy Stonefly Nymph Trout Fly imitate a key stage in a fish's diet?
The Large Light Heavy Stonefly Nymph fly imitates the nymph stage of the stonefly, a crucial part of a trout's diet. Stoneflies are aquatic insects that spend most of their life as nymphs, clinging to the undersides of rocks in fast-flowing streams. During the nymph stage, they are a prime target for trout due to their abundance and high protein content. As they prepare to emerge, nymphs become more active, making them more visible and accessible to fish. This fly's design, with its weighted body and realistic profile, effectively mimics the natural movement and appearance of a stonefly nymph, enticing trout to strike.
